DOCUMENT:Q248747 08-AUG-2001 [winnt] TITLE :Error Message: STOP 0x00000041 MUST_SUCCEED_POOL_EMPTY PRODUCT :Microsoft Windows NT PROD/VER:winnt:4.0 OPER/SYS: KEYWORDS:kb3rdparty ====================================================================== ------------------------------------------------------------------------------- The information in this article applies to: - Microsoft Windows NT Server version 4.0 - Microsoft Windows NT Server, Enterprise Edition version 4.0 - Microsoft Windows NT Server version 4.0, Terminal Server Edition - Microsoft Windows NT Workstation version 4.0 ------------------------------------------------------------------------------- SYMPTOMS ======== You may receive a "STOP 0x00000041 MUST_SUCCEED_POOL_EMPTY" error message on a blue screen when the requested memory allocation cannot be satisfied for the NonPagedPoolMustSucceed pool type for the ExAllocatePoolWithTag function. RESOLUTION ========== If you receive this error message, verify the version of the third-party Ncrbynet.sys driver that is being used. The following version of the Ncrbynet.sys file is known to cause a memory leak condition with Windows NT: Ncrbynet.sys Tue Oct 26 11:37:23 1999 To resolve this issue, contact NCR Corporation for an updated driver. MORE INFORMATION ================ There is a limit of roughly 128 MB in Windows NT 4.0 on the amount of NonPaged Pool memory that is available to a system. This is a hard-coded value that cannot be modified.
